Location: |
|
Thunder Bay is
the larges
city in
Northern and
Northwestern
Ontario and is
located on
Highway 11/17
on the
northwestern
shores of Lake
Superior.
The city is
just 45
minutes north
of the Ontario
/ Minnesota
border via
highway 64. |

Access /
Airports /
Transportation: |
|
Thunder Bay is
a major
transportation
center for the
north and its
International
Airport is
served by
several
airlines and
charter
companies.
You can book
direct flights
to Thunder Bay
from
Minneapolis
via Northwest
Airlines.
Flights can be
booked to
virtually any
destination in
Canada with
WestJet
Airlines, Air
Canada Jazz
and Canada
North.
If you plan to
drive to
Thunder Bay,
the city is
about 3 hours
north of
Duluth Mn via
hwy 64 / 685
km East of
Winnipeg via
hwy 17 and 690
km west of
Sault Ste
Marie via hwy
17. |

Accommodations
/ Services /
Attractions /
Events: |
|
There are
numerous
fishing lodges
and outfitters
located
throughout the
regions to the
North and west
of the city
who cater to
sportsmen,
family groups
and outdoor
enthusiasts.
Visitors who
want to spend
a few days in
Thunder Bay
will find a
great
selection of
first class
hotels and
motels,
restaurants
and shopping.
You can spend
the afternoon
taking a sail
boat charter
on Lake
Superior or
book a salmon
fishing
charter boat
with a group
of friends.
The activities
and
attractions in
and around
Thunder Bay
are virtually
unlimited.
